Boa noite, eu gostaria de saber o por que da terceira questão estar errada, uma vez que o enunciado não especifica a chave do Dictionary a ser utilizada.
Boa noite, eu gostaria de saber o por que da terceira questão estar errada, uma vez que o enunciado não especifica a chave do Dictionary a ser utilizada.
Olá Renan!
Dicionários trabalham com chave e valor, ou seja, você associa um valor a uma chave única, assim como nos bancos de dados. O valor está ligado a chave e não ao contrário. Na primeira opção está ligando o númeroMatricula
ao Aluno
. Isso quer dizer que você encontra o aluno pelo número da matrícula dele.
Na terceira opção, você iria encontrar o número da matrícula a partir do aluno, sendo que o aluno já tem o número de matrícula.
A opção 3 seria como se um array tivesse nomes de frutas como índices e os valores fossem números. Pode ter um cenário que faça sentido, mas não acredito que seja para este caso :)
Espero ter ajudado!